What is fee-only financial planning?

Fee-only financial planning is a type of financial advisory service where the planner is compensated solely by the client and does not receive commissions or incentives from selling financial products. This approach helps eliminate potential conflicts of interest, ensuring advice is focused on the client's best interests. Fee-only planners typically charge hourly rates, flat fees, or a percentage of assets under management. They provide comprehensive financial guidance, including retirement, investment, tax, and estate planning.

How does a fee-only financial planner collaborate with clients and other professionals to develop comprehensive financial plans?

Fee-only financial planners work closely with clients to understand their unique financial goals, gathering detailed information about income, expenses, investments, and risk tolerance. They often collaborate with other professionals, such as tax advisors, estate attorneys, and insurance agents, to ensure all aspects of a client’s financial life are addressed. Regular meetings and clear communication are essential, as planners must update plans in response to life changes or market conditions. Building trust and maintaining transparency about fees and recommendations are key to long-term client relationships.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a fee-only financial planner,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Fee Only Financial Planner, you need a deep understanding of personal finance, investment strategies, and regulatory requirements, often supported by a CFP (Certified Financial Planner) certification or similar credentials. Familiarity with financial planning software, portfolio management tools, and compliance systems is typically required. Exceptional interpersonal skills, integrity, and the ability to communicate complex financial concepts clearly set top professionals apart. These skills are crucial to building trust, delivering objective advice, and helping clients achieve their financial goals without conflicts of interest.

Fee Only Financial Planning refers to a payment model where advisors charge clients directly for their services without commissions. Certified Financial Planner (CFP) is a professional designation indicating a high level of expertise and adherence to ethical standards. While many Fee Only Financial Planners are CFPs, not all are, and the designation emphasizes credentials, whereas fee-only describes the payment structure.

Job Description:
Responsibilities:
  • Lead financial analysis, modeling, and reporting to support strategic decision-making.
  • Own monthly, quarterly, and annual performance reporting, including variance analysis and actionable insights.
  • Develop and enhance forecasting models, partnering with FP&A leadership to improve accuracy and transparency.
  • Analyze key drivers of revenue, expenses, profitability, and cash flow to identify trends and risks.
  • Support budgeting processes by coordinating inputs, validating assumptions, and ensuring alignment with corporate strategy.
  • Prepare executive-ready presentations and dashboards that communicate financial performance clearly and succinctly.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Accounting, Operations, and senior leadership to ensure financial data integrity and alignment.
  • Drive continuous improvement through automation, process optimization, and enhancement of analytical tools.
  • Evaluate business cases, investment opportunities, and scenario analyses to support strategic initiatives.
  • Provide guidance and mentorship to junior analysts to strengthen overall team capability.
  • Perform some administrative functions for the SAP Business Planning and Consolidation, BPC, financial planning system.
  • Build and maintain desk procedures.
  • Special Projects and ad-hoc analysis as assigned.

Education requirement:
Bachelor's degree in accounting, Finance or Economics required
Knowledge, skills, and abilities:
  • 5 years in accounting or FP&A function.
  • Highly proficient personal digital literacy, Proficient in SAP and MS Office (specifically Excel) and technology driven. Experience with SAP Business, Planning and Consolidation a plus.
  • Understanding in the areas of US GAAP, Cost Accounting and Manufacturing finance a plus.
  • Ability to plan, implement, and administer financial information and control systems.
  • Demonstrates problem solving and analytical abilities on complex topics.
  • Strong social skills and proven commitment to teamwork.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ills.
  • Demonstrates ability to prioritize assignments/projects and multi-task within restricted time restraints.
